动态网站开发:数据库与后端技术高效整合实战

动态网站开发中,数据库与后端技术的整合是实现功能的核心。后端负责处理业务逻辑和数据交互,而数据库则存储和管理数据,两者需要高效协作才能保证网站的稳定运行。

选择合适的数据库类型对项目至关重要。关系型数据库如MySQL、PostgreSQL适合需要复杂查询和事务处理的应用;非关系型数据库如MongoDB则适用于大规模数据存储和高并发场景。

AI绘图结果,仅供参考

后端开发通常使用PHP、Python、Node.js等语言,这些语言提供了丰富的库和框架来简化数据库操作。例如,使用ORM(对象关系映射)工具可以将数据库表转换为代码中的对象,提升开发效率。

数据库连接配置是整合过程中的关键步骤。开发者需要设置正确的主机名、端口、用户名和密码,确保后端能够安全访问数据库。同时,使用环境变量管理敏感信息,避免硬编码带来的安全隐患。

在实际开发中,通过API接口实现前后端分离已成为主流。后端提供RESTful API,前端通过HTTP请求获取或提交数据,这种方式提高了系统的可维护性和扩展性。

定期优化数据库查询和索引,有助于提升系统性能。避免过多的联表查询,合理设计表结构,可以减少响应时间,提高用户体验。

dawei

【声明】:丽水站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复